On Mon, 4 Jun 2007, Johannes Sixt wrote:
> [...] any simple command like
>
> git filter-branch -k orgin/master origin/next new-next
>
> of your git.git clone will fail with the "assertion failed". (I haven't
> tried your script, yet, but cg-admin-rewritehist fails.)
As you mentioned yourself, you should say "-s origin/next".
cg-admin-rewritehist will only rewrite the current branch (since cogito
started out as one-branch-per-repo).
> I propose that you just get rid of the "seed" stance and don't fail if a
> commit cannot be mapped - just use it unchanged (don't forget to adjust
> the map() function, too).
It is as much for debug reasons as for consistency, so I'd rather keep it.
One more safety valve for catching bugs.
> Then you can get rid of -r and use -k to specify everything you want
> under "--not" in the rev-list.
Actually, -r is quite useful. It means "start rewriting with this commit",
and saying "--not <commit>^" is _not_ the same when <commit> is a merge.
